The Power of the Subaru Ascent
Under the hood of the 2019 Subaru Ascent lies a powerful 2.4-liter turbocharged four-cylinder engine that delivers up to 260 horsepower and 277 pound-feet of torque. Thanks to this impressive powertrain, the Ascent can tow up to 5,000 pounds, making it an ideal choice for towing boats, trailers, or other outdoor equipment.
The Ascent also features a continuously variable transmission (CVT) that optimizes power delivery and fuel efficiency. Additionally, the SUV comes standard with Subaru's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ive system, which provides enhanced traction and stability in all driving conditions.

The Ascent's towing capacity is just one of the many benefits of owning this versatile SUV. Here are a few more reasons why the Ascent is the perfect choice for outdoor enthusiasts:
Spacious Interior:
The Ascent offers ample seating for up to eight passengers, making it ideal for large families or groups. The SUV also boasts up to 86.5 cubic feet of cargo space, providing plenty of room for all your gear.
Advanced Safety Features:
Standard safety features on the 2019 Ascent include Subaru's EyeSight Driver Assist Technology, which includes adaptive cruise control, lane departure warning, and pre-collision braking. These features provide added peace of mind when towing heavy loads on the highway.
Tips for Towing with the Ascent
While the 2019 Subaru Ascent is designed for towing, there are a few things to keep in mind when hauling heavy loads. Here are a few tips to ensure a safe and successful towing experience:
Check Your Hitch:
Before towing, make sure your hitch is properly installed and rated for the weight of your load. Be sure to also check your hitch ball and trailer coupler for any signs of wear or damage.
Distribute Weight Evenly:
When loading your trailer, be sure to distribute weight evenly to prevent swaying or fishtailing. Make sure the heaviest items are positioned over the trailer's axles and that the load is secured with straps or chains.
